Skip to content

Commit 0955544

Browse files
committed
Move startup loading script to renderer.js
1 parent cd30b11 commit 0955544

File tree

2 files changed

+14
-21
lines changed

2 files changed

+14
-21
lines changed

index.html

+2-20
Original file line numberDiff line numberDiff line change
@@ -54,30 +54,12 @@
5454
</div>
5555
</div>
5656

57-
<!-- Spinner -->
57+
<!-- Loading Spinner -->
5858
<div id="spinner">
5959
<div class="lds-ellipsis">
60-
<div></div>
61-
<div></div>
62-
<div></div>
63-
<div></div>
60+
<div></div><div></div><div></div><div></div>
6461
</div>
6562
</div>
66-
<script>
67-
function showSpinner() {
68-
// document.querySelector('.lds-ellipsis').style.display = 'inline-block';
69-
document.getElementById('spinner').style.zIndex = 10;
70-
}
71-
72-
function hideSpinner() {
73-
document.getElementById('spinner').style.display = 'none';
74-
}
75-
76-
// Example usage:
77-
showSpinner();
78-
setTimeout(hideSpinner, 3000); // Hide spinner after 3 seconds
79-
</script>
80-
8163
<script src="https://unpkg.com/axios/dist/axios.min.js"></script> <!-- Import axios -->
8264
<script src="./renderer.js"></script>
8365
</body>

renderer.js

+12-1
Original file line numberDiff line numberDiff line change
@@ -172,4 +172,15 @@ function createParagraphs(text) {
172172
p.innerHTML = texts[i];
173173
answerDiv.appendChild(p);
174174
}
175-
}
175+
}
176+
177+
function showSpinner() {
178+
document.getElementById('spinner').style.zIndex = 10;
179+
}
180+
181+
function hideSpinner() {
182+
document.getElementById('spinner').style.display = 'none';
183+
}
184+
185+
showSpinner();
186+
setTimeout(hideSpinner, 4000); // Hide spinner after 3 seconds

0 commit comments

Comments
 (0)